Turkey Meatballs in Pumpkin Sage Sauce

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/2 cups fresh breadcrumbs
  • 3 tablespoons milk
  • 1/2 cup finely minced onion
  • 4 garlic cloves, pressed through garlic press
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h sage
  • 1 tablespoon chopped parsley
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 cup grated parmesan
  • 1 large whole egg plus 1 yolk
  • 1 1/2 pounds ground turkey
  • 1 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• Olive oil or avocado oil, for brushing over top and lightly frying
  • 2 tablespoons ghee
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1/2 cup finely minced onion
  • 6 cloves garlic, pressed through garlic press
  • 2 teaspoons Italian seasoning
  • 15 ounce can organic pumpkin puree
  • 1 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 3/4 cups chicken stock
  • 1/2 cup grated par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up heavy cream
  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h sage

Instructions

  1. In a large mixing bowl, soak breadcrumbs in milk for 2-3 minutes. Add minced onion, garlic, sage, parsley, Italian seasoning, parmesan, egg, and mix until combined.
  2. Gently fold in ground turkey along with salt and pepper until just mixed. Chill the mixture for 20-25 minutes.
  3. Shape the mixture into meatballs and sear them in a heated skillet until browned.
  4. For the sauce, sauté onion and garlic in ghee, then whisk in pumpkin puree and chicken stock. Stir in cream, parmesan cheese, maple syrup, and sage.
  5. Combine cooked meatballs with the sauce and simmer before serving.
